Jogging routes around Obertshausen are set within the thickly wooded eastern part of the Rhine-Main lowland, offering picturesque landscapes and abundant green spaces. The region is characterized by diverse forests, fields, meadows, and floodplains, providing varied terrain for running. While predominantly a plain area, some running trails do feature elevation gains, making the routes accessible for various fitness levels. The proximity to the Mainufer also provides scenic running opportunities along the river banks.

The Dietesheim quarries are a small recreational area in Mühlheim am Main in Hesse. You hike on small paths through shady forest and circle one lake after another. Steep rock faces from the former basalt open-cast mine appear again and again. There are 3 designated routes for hiking (indicated on the sign). You will also meet a lot of cyclists. A little tip: don't forget mosquito spray.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available in Obertshausen?

Obertshausen offers a wide selection of running routes, with over 85 trails available for exploration. These routes cater to various fitness levels, including easy, moderate, and difficult options.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the jogging trails around Obertshausen?

The jogging trails in Obertshausen feature diverse terrain, ranging from thickly wooded areas and open fields to meadows and floodplains. While the Rhine-Main area is predominantly flat, some routes do include elevation gains, offering varied challenges. Many paths are mostly paved, but you'll also find unpaved surfaces, especially on routes like the Dirt Path Through Countryside – Mutter Gabi Beer Garden loop.

Are there any family-friendly running routes in Obertshausen?

Yes, Obertshausen has several routes suitable for families. The town's green spaces, like Beethovenpark and Waldspielpark, offer varied play and relaxation zones alongside paths. For a specific route, the Running loop from See am Goldberg is a moderate 3.5-mile trail through green spaces that can be enjoyed by families.

Can I bring my dog on the running trails in Obertshausen?

Many of Obertshausen's natural areas, including its extensive forests and fields, are generally dog-friendly. It's always recommended to keep dogs on a leash, especially in nature reserves or near wildlife. The varied terrain and numerous green spaces provide ample opportunities for you and your canine companion to enjoy a run together.

Are there circular running routes available?

Yes, many of the running routes in Obertshausen are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ular example is the Vogelsberger Lake – Steinheim Gallows loop, which offers a moderate 9-mile circular trail connecting a lake and a historical site.

What are some scenic landmarks or attractions I can see while running in Obertshausen?

Obertshausen's routes offer views of picturesque landscapes and natural features. You can encounter historical sites like the Old Town, Steinheim am Main or the Steinheim Customs Tower. Natural highlights include the Vogelsberg Lake and the Dietesheim Quarries. The proximity to the Mainufer also provides scenic riverbank views.

What is the best time of year for running in Obertshausen?

Obertshausen, located in the Rhine-Main lowland, generally experiences a mild climate, making it suitable for running throughout much of the year. The diverse forests and fields offer pleasant conditions in spring and autumn with vibrant foliage, while the ample shade in areas like Waldspielpark can be beneficial during warmer summer months. Winter running is also possible, though conditions may vary.

Are there any running routes with good parking access?

Many running routes in and around Obertshausen are accessible by car, with parking available near trailheads or in local recreation areas. For example, routes starting from areas like Mayengewann von Lämmerspiel or Gräbenwäldchesfeld von Hausen often have convenient parking options nearby.

Are there any cafes or refreshment stops along the running routes?

While specific cafes directly on every trail might be limited, Obertshausen and its surrounding towns offer various options for refreshments. The Dirt Path Through Countryside – Mutter Gabi Beer Garden loop, for instance, passes by the Mutter Gabi Beer Garden. The town center and areas near popular parks like See am Goldberg also provide opportunities for a post-run coffee or meal.

What do other runners say about the trails in Obertshausen?

The running routes in Obertshausen are highly regarded by the komoot community, boasting an average rating of 4.2 stars from over 70 reviews. Runners frequently praise the varied terrain, the abundance of green spaces, and the well-maintained paths that make for an enjoyable outdoor experience. Over 1000 runners have used komoot to explore the area's diverse trails.

Are there routes with significant elevation changes for a more challenging run?

While Obertshausen is in a predominantly plain area, some running trails do feature noticeable elevation gains, offering a more challenging workout. For example, the Heusenstammer Weg – Patershausen Estate loop is classified as difficult and includes more significant elevation changes over its 9.7-mile distance.

How accessible are the running routes by public transport?

Obertshausen is well-connected within the Rhine-Main region, making many running routes accessible via public transport. You can often reach starting points of trails from local bus stops or train stations, especially for routes closer to the town center or connecting to nearby communities. It's advisable to check local transport schedules for specific route access.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ly jogging routes?

Yes, Obertshausen offers several easy and moderate routes perfect for beginners or those looking for a less strenuous run. The town's numerous green spaces and parks provide gentle paths. A good option is the Running loop from Hengster, a moderate 4-mile trail with minimal elevation, ideal for a relaxed jog.
